# Customs Bonded Area

A customs bonded area allows imported goods to be stored, processed, or transhipped without triggering duty or import tax obligations at the point of arrival. The area operates under continuous customs supervision; liability for duties arises only when goods are released for domestic consumption or declared for export. Importers, manufacturers, and traders use bonded areas to defer duty payments, preserve cash flow, and maintain flexibility over final destination—particularly valuable when tariff rates are high or when the commercial decision between local sale and re-export is still open. Bonded areas should not be confused with free trade zones, which may also offer VAT or excise advantages depending on national legislation.
